Subject: Re: [PATCH v3 18/22] qga: don't disable fsfreeze commands if vss_init fails

> The fsfreeze commands are already written to report an error if
> vss_init() fails. Reporting a more specific error message is more
> helpful than a generic "command is disabled" message, which cannot
> between an admin config decision and lack of platform support.

>  qga/commands-win32.c | 18 +++---------------
>  qga/main.c           |  4 ++++
>  2 files changed, 7 insertions(+), 15 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/qga/commands-win32.c b/qga/commands-win32.c
> index 2533e4c748..5866cc2e3c 100644
> --- a/qga/commands-win32.c
> +++ b/qga/commands-win32.c
> @@ -1203,7 +1203,7 @@ GuestFilesystemInfoList *qmp_guest_get_fsinfo(Error
> **errp)
>  GuestFsfreezeStatus qmp_guest_fsfreeze_status(Error **errp)
>  {
>      if (!vss_initialized()) {
> -        error_setg(errp, QERR_UNSUPPORTED);
> +        error_setg(errp, "fsfreeze not possible as VSS failed to
> initialize");
>          return 0;
>      }
>
> @@ -1231,7 +1231,7 @@ int64_t qmp_guest_fsfreeze_freeze_list(bool
> has_mountpoints,
>      Error *local_err = NULL;
>
>      if (!vss_initialized()) {
> -        error_setg(errp, QERR_UNSUPPORTED);
> +        error_setg(errp, "fsfreeze not possible as VSS failed to
> initialize");
>          return 0;
>      }
>
> @@ -1266,7 +1266,7 @@ int64_t qmp_guest_fsfreeze_thaw(Error **errp)
>      int i;
>
>      if (!vss_initialized()) {
> -        error_setg(errp, QERR_UNSUPPORTED);
> +        error_setg(errp, "fsfreeze not possible as VSS failed to
> initialize");
>          return 0;
>      }
>
> @@ -1961,18 +1961,6 @@ done:
>  /* add unsupported commands to the list of blocked RPCs */
>  GList *ga_command_init_blockedrpcs(GList *blockedrpcs)
>  {
> -    if (!vss_init(true)) {
> -        g_debug("vss_init failed, vss commands are going to be disabled");
> -        const char *list[] = {
> -            "guest-get-fsinfo", "guest-fsfreeze-status",
> -            "guest-fsfreeze-freeze", "guest-fsfreeze-thaw", NULL};
> -        char **p = (char **)list;
> -
> -        while (*p) {
> -            blockedrpcs = g_list_append(blockedrpcs, g_strdup(*p++));
> -        }
> -    }
> -
>      return blockedrpcs;
>  }
>
> diff --git a/qga/main.c b/qga/main.c
> index f4d5f15bb3..17b6ce18ac 100644
> --- a/qga/main.c
> +++ b/qga/main.c
> @@ -1395,6 +1395,10 @@ static GAState *initialize_agent(GAConfig *config,
> int socket_activation)
>                     " '%s': %s", config->state_dir, strerror(errno));
>          return NULL;
>      }
> +
> +    if (!vss_init(true)) {
> +        g_debug("vss_init failed, vss commands will not function");
> +    }
>  #endif
>
